Prediction and head to head Carlos Gimeno Valero vs. Diego Hidalgo
There is no head to head record between Carlos Gimeno Valero and Diego Hidalgo since this will be the first time that they will play each other in the main tour.
Carlos Gimeno Valero
Ranked no. 266, the Spaniard will start his run in the Segovia Challenger after he played his last match in the Almaty 2 Challenger where he lost 6-4 7-6(6) to Schnur in the 2nd round on the 16th of June.
Gimeno Valero has an overall 19-12 win-loss record in 2021, 0-1 on hard (See FULL STATS).
Gimeno Valero’s best result of the current season was reaching the final in the Gran Canaria 2 Challenger and M25 Vic.
Talking about his overall career, Gimeno Valero has an overall 50-21 record. He has a positive 5-3 record on hard.
Previously in the Segovia Challenger
Gimeno Valero has never competed in this tournament before.
Diego Hidalgo
Ranked no. 456, Hidalgo will start his run in the Segovia Challenger after he played his last match in the Pozoblanco Challenger where he lost 7-6(4) 6-3 to Geerts in the qualifications on the 19th of July.
The Ecuadorian has a composed 12-13 win-loss record in 2021, 4-6 on hard (See FULL STATS).
In terms of his career, Diego has an overall 156-100 record. He has a positive 52-37 record on hard.
